The JCR Browser http://sourceforge.net/projects/jcrbrowser/ is implemented as an Eclipse plugin. It can connect to repositories through various means of remoting and provides very nice views of all the meta-data and user data. The only shortcoming is that it's read only.
I also use a WebDAV client to do writing. http://www.davexplorer.org/ This is pretty good. Neither of these are all that outstanding. I saw another project on google code, but it's community seemed to be limited to a single company's developers. Despite the small community, it seemed to have better functioanlity than these two.
